Wall Street experienced one of its most brutal sell-offs of the year as a surprise breakthrough from Chinese artificial intelligence startup DeepSeek triggered a massive global rout in AI tech stocks. Silicon Valley darlings and semiconductor giants saw hundreds of billions in market cap evaporate within hours as investors scrambled to reassess the dominance of American tech titans. DeepSeek's open-weights model reportedly matches or surpasses Western flagship models at a fraction of the computational and financial cost, shattering the long-held assumption that massive capital expenditure is the only path to frontier AI.

The panic spilled over onto social media platforms like Bluesky and X, where tech analysts and retail traders alike watched the crimson market boards in real-time disbelief. Heavyweights like Nvidia, Microsoft, and Alphabet suffered steep declines, pulling down major indices including the Nasdaq and the S&P 500. The viral ripple effect quickly spread to European and Asian markets, creating a synchronized global retreat. Market watchers are calling it the 'DeepSeek Shock', arguing that China's leap in algorithmic efficiency threatens the multi-trillion-dollar infrastructure moat built by Western tech cartels over the past three years.

For months, big tech firms justified eye-watering data center investments by claiming scale was everything in the generative AI race. However, DeepSeek's novel architecture proves that smart training techniques and efficiency optimizations can undercut brute-force compute budgets. Analysts note that if top-tier intelligence can be commoditized on a budget, the astronomical valuations of hardware providers and cloud platforms could be heading for a permanent correction.

As the dust settles heading into the weekend, tech leaders are left grappling with an entirely altered landscape. The geopolitical and economic ramifications are profound, signaling a potential shift in the global AI balance of power. Whether this sell-off is a temporary overreaction or the beginning of a prolonged valuation reset, one thing is clear: the AI arms race has entered a chaotic, hyper-competitive new era where hardware supremacy no longer guarantees an unbeatable lead.
